Google Workspace CLI
Expert guidance and automation for Google Workspace administration using the open-source gws CLI (github.com/googleworkspace/cli, Apache-2.0). The CLI builds its command surface dynamically from Google's Discovery Service, so it covers every supported Workspace API plus +-prefixed helper commands. This skill adds local Python tools (doctor, auth guide, recipe catalog, security audit, output analyzer).
> Verify before scripting: gws generates commands at runtime from Google's API discovery documents, and the CLI is pre-v1.0. Always confirm a command's exact surface with gws --help, gws <service> --help, or gws schema <service>.<resource>.<method> before putting it in automation. Commands in this skill marked *(verify)* are illustrative of the gws <service> <resource> <method> pattern and must be checked against your installed version.

Installation
npm (recommended; requires Node.js 18+)
npm install -g @googleworkspace/cli
gws --versionHomebrew (macOS/Linux)
brew install googleworkspace-cliCargo (from source)
cargo install --git https://github.com/googleworkspace/cli --locked
gws --versionPre-built Binaries
Download from github.com/googleworkspace/cli/releases for macOS, Linux, or Windows. Nix users: nix run github:googleworkspace/cli.

Authentication
OAuth Setup (Interactive)
# Step 1: Create Google Cloud project and OAuth credentials
python3 scripts/auth_setup_guide.py --guide oauth
Step 2: Run interactive auth setup (uses gcloud if available)
gws auth setup
Step 3: Log in, requesting only the scopes you need
gws auth login -s drive,gmail,sheetsHeadless/CI
# Generate setup instructions
python3 scripts/auth_setup_guide.py --guide service-account
Export credentials from an interactive machine, then point the CLI at them
gws auth export --unmasked > credentials.json
export GOOGLE_WORKSPACE_CLI_CREDENTIALS_FILE=/path/to/credentials.jsonEnvironment Variables
# Generate .env template
python3 scripts/auth_setup_guide.py --generate-env| Variable | Purpose |
|----------|---------|
| GOOGLE_WORKSPACE_CLI_CLIENT_ID | OAuth client ID |
| GOOGLE_WORKSPACE_CLI_CLIENT_SECRET | OAuth client secret |
| GOOGLE_WORKSPACE_CLI_CREDENTIALS_FILE | Path to exported credentials JSON |
| GOOGLE_WORKSPACE_CLI_TOKEN | Pre-obtained OAuth token |
| GOOGLE_WORKSPACE_CLI_CONFIG_DIR | Override default config location |
| GOOGLE_WORKSPACE_CLI_LOG | Enable debug logging |

Workflow 1: Gmail Automation
Goal: Automate email operations — send, search, label, and filter management.
Send, Reply, Forward (helper commands)
# Send a new email
gws gmail +send --to "[email protected]" \
--subject "Proposal" --body "Please find attached..."
Reply to a message (auto-threading); check exact flags with: gws gmail +reply --help
gws gmail +reply ...
Forward a message; check exact flags with: gws gmail +forward --help
gws gmail +forward ...
Unread inbox summary
gws gmail +triageSearch and Inspect (discovery commands)
Discovery commands follow gws <service> <resource> <method> and take request
parameters as JSON via --params (query/path params) and --json (request body).
Inspect any method's exact schema first:
# What does messages.list accept? (verify)
gws schema gmail.users.messages.list
Search emails (verify against the schema above)
gws gmail users messages list --params '{"userId": "me", "q": "from:[email protected] after:2025/01/01"}' \
| python3 scripts/output_analyzer.py --count
List labels (verify)
gws gmail users labels list --params '{"userId": "me"}'Bulk Operations
Use --dry-run first, and --page-all to paginate (one JSON line per page):
# Preview, then archive read emails older than 30 days (verify method schema first)
gws gmail users messages list --params '{"userId": "me", "q": "is:read older_than:30d"}' --page-all \
| python3 scripts/output_analyzer.py --select "id" --format json
Then feed ids to gmail users messages modify (see: gws schema gmail.users.messages.modify)

Best Practices
Security
1. Use OAuth with minimal scopes — request only what each workflow needs
2. Store tokens in the system keyring, never in plain text files
3. Rotate service account keys every 90 days
4. Audit third-party OAuth app grants quarterly
5. Use --dry-run before bulk destructive operations
Automation
1. All gws output is structured JSON — pipe it through output_analyzer.py for filtering and aggregation
2. Use gws workflow +* helpers for multi-step operations instead of chaining raw commands
3. Use the local recipe catalog (gws_recipe_runner.py) as command templates, then verify each against gws --help
4. --page-all emits one JSON line per page (NDJSON) for streaming large result sets
5. Use --dry-run to preview any request before executing it
Performance
1. Request only needed fields via the API's fields parameter in --params (reduces payload size)
2. Use pageSize in --params to cap results when browsing
3. Use --page-all only when you need complete datasets; tune with --page-limit / --page-delay
4. Prefer + helpers (single optimized calls) over hand-chained API calls
5. Cache frequently accessed data (e.g., label IDs, folder IDs) in variables

Limitations
| Constraint | Impact |
|------------|--------|
| OAuth tokens expire after 1 hour | Re-auth needed for long-running scripts |
| API rate limits (per-user, per-service) | Bulk operations may hit 429 errors |
| Scope requirements vary by service | Must request correct scopes during auth |
| Pre-v1.0 CLI status | Breaking changes possible between releases |
| Google Cloud project required | Free, but requires setup in Cloud Console |
| Admin API needs admin privileges | Some audit checks require Workspace Admin role |
